Caroline Pham, acting chair of the Commodity Futures Trading Commission (CFTC), is departing after four years to become MoonPay's Chief Legal and Administrative Officer. Her move follows a growing trend of regulators transitioning to crypto-native roles, mirroring former White House crypto Council executive director Bo Hines' recent shift to Tether.

Pham will oversee MoonPay's global legal operations and regulatory strategy in Washington. At Citigroup, she spent seven years before joining the CFTC in 2022. Her vacancy will be filled by crypto attorney Mike Selig, pending Senate confirmation next week.
